Family Friendly 3-Day Itinerary in Rishikesh

Saturday, November 18: Exploring the Spiritual Side of Rishikesh

Start your trip by immersing yourself in the serene and spiritual vibes of Rishikesh. In the morning, visit the iconic Parmarth Niketan Ashram, located on the banks of the holy Ganges river. Attend the morning yoga and meditation session to find inner peace and tranquility. In the afternoon, take a stroll across the iconic Laxman Jhula, a suspension bridge offering breathtaking views of the river and the surrounding mountains. Visit the Beatles Ashram, also known as the Maharishi Mahesh Yogi Ashram, where the Beatles stayed in 1968. In the evening, witness the captivating Ganga Aarti ceremony at Triveni Ghat, where priests perform rituals dedicated to the sacred river.

  • Parmarth Niketan Ashram: Entrance fee: INR 150 ($2), Time Spent: 2-3 hours
  • Laxman Jhula: Free, Time Spent: 1-2 hours
  • Beatles Ashram: Entrance fee: INR 150 ($2), Time Spent: 1-2 hours
  • Triveni Ghat: Free, Time Spent: 1 hour
Sunday, November 19: Adventure in Rishikesh

Get ready for an adrenaline-filled day of adventure in Rishikesh. In the morning, embark on a thrilling white-water rafting expedition on the Ganges river. Enjoy the rush of navigating the rapids amidst the picturesque surroundings. After a refreshing lunch, head for a thrilling experience of zip-lining and rock climbing at Shivpuri, known for its natural beauty and adventure activities. In the evening, unwind with a peaceful riverside walk and enjoy the serenity of Rishikesh.

  • White-water Rafting: Cost per person: INR 1500-2500 ($20-$35), Time Spent: 3-4 hours
  • Zip-lining and Rock Climbing in Shivpuri: Cost per person: INR 1000-1500 ($14-$20), Time Spent: 2-3 hours
Monday, November 20: Cultural Delights and Shopping

Immerse yourself in the rich culture and vibrant atmosphere of Rishikesh on your final day. In the morning, visit the Neelkanth Mahadev Temple, located amidst the lush greenery of the Pauri Garhwal district. Explore the temple complex and enjoy the scenic beauty of the surrounding mountains. Indulge in a delicious lunch at one of the local vegetarian restaurants, known for their authentic and flavorful cuisine. Spend the afternoon exploring the local markets, such as the Laxman Jhula Market and the Ram Jhula Market, where you can shop for spiritual artifacts, clothing, and handicrafts. In the evening, relax by the Ganges and witness the enchanting Ganga Aarti ceremony at Parmarth Niketan Ashram.

  • Neelkanth Mahadev Temple: Entrance fee: Free, Time Spent: 1-2 hours
  • Lunch at a Local Restaurant: Cost per person: INR 300-500 ($4-$7), Time Spent: 1 hour
  • Shopping at Laxman Jhula Market and Ram Jhula Market: Cost varies, Time Spent: 2-3 hours
  • Ganga Aarti at Parmarth Niketan Ashram: Free, Time Spent: 1 hour

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For some off the beaten path attractions and places loved by locals, consider visiting the Vashishta Gufa, located a few kilometers away from Rishikesh. It is a serene cave where it is believed that the sage Vashishta meditated. Another hidden gem is the Kunjapuri Devi Temple, which offers panoramic views of the Himalayas, especially during sunrise or sunset. These spots allow you to connect with nature and experience the serenity of Rishikesh away from the crowds. Additionally, take a leisurely walk along the serene Tapovan area, known for its peaceful ambiance and natural beauty.
